Zhang Yiwei (Chinese: 张义威; pinyin: Zhāng Yīwěi; Mandarin pronunciation: [ʈʂáŋ î wéɪ]; born 3 October 1992) is a Chinese snowboarder. He is a participant at the 2014 Winter Olympics in Sochi.[1][2]

In early 2015, Zhang Yiwei landed the first triple cork ever in a half-pipe.[3]
